Plot Summary
During a nationwide lockdown, a young couple finds themselves targeted by a dangerous intruder in their own home. As the situation escalates, they must fight for survival against an unknown assailant whose motives are as terrifying as his presence. The film explores themes of isolation and paranoia in a world turned upside down by a global crisis.
Critical Reception
Stay Home received a mixed to negative reception, primarily criticized for its predictable plot and underdeveloped characters. While some acknowledged its timely theme of quarantine, many found the execution to be derivative of other home invasion thrillers. Audience scores were similarly lukewarm.
